In Tollywood, it's becoming common to split stories into two parts. Many upcoming films are adopting this strategy. However, the success of the first part is crucial in setting the stage for the second. Some films that hinted at sequels ended up reconsidering after the first part's performance. Recent releases like Skanda and Peddha Kaapu faced this situation when their first parts didn't do well, raising doubts about the second installment.

Despite the uncertainty surrounding hits and flops, the trend of sequels is gaining momentum in Tollywood. Director Koratala Shiva recently announced a two-part film with Jr NTR titled Devara. Now, Mega Power Star Ram Charan has also jumped on the sequel bandwagon.

Ram Charan, known for his massive films, has signed his next project with Buchi Babu, the director of the hit film Uppena. The movie is expected to have a grand scale and a substantial budget. Buchi Babu has reportedly crafted an engaging story for the film, and it's rumored that the project might be split into two parts. The delay in the shooting of Charan's current project, Game Changer, has had an impact on Buchi Babu's movie. The official shooting for Charan's film with Buchi Babu is expected to commence in December or January.

While there were earlier rumors about Buchi Babu teaming up with NTR, it didn't materialize. Now, the makers of RC16 (Ram Charan's 16th film) want to ensure they have a solid script. In today's cinema landscape, two-part films and sequels have been performing well at the box office, offering more creative freedom and budget flexibility.

All in all, Ram Charan and Buchi Babu's film is poised to become a significant release in the near future.
